Custom Nylon Webbing

Our elastic shock absorbing lanyard webbing is a high-performance product designed for demanding applications. With a width of 20MM and thickness of 3MM, it offers excellent durability and strength. Made from high-quality nylon material, it has a strength of over 15kN, making it suitable for heavy-duty uses such as climbing harnesses, tool belts, and running belts. The webbing features good color fastness at grade 4, ensuring that the color remains vibrant even after prolonged use. Its elastic properties provide effective shock absorption, enhancing safety and comfort. This product is an ideal choice for outdoor activities and industrial applications where reliability and performance are crucial.

Product Parameters

Width:20MM

Thickness:3MM

Material:Nylon

Strength:15kN (Measured more than)

Color fastness:4grade

Use range: Climbing harness, Tool belt, running belt


Custom nylon webbing is a versatile material engineered to meet specific performance requirements across industries, from safety equipment to fashion accessories. Below is a structured overview of its key aspects:

1. Core Properties

  • Strength & Durability:

    • High tensile strength (up to 8,000 PSI) and abrasion resistance make it ideal for load-bearing applications like climbing harnesses, cargo straps, and military gear.

    • Resistant to mold, mildew, and UV degradation, ensuring longevity in outdoor environments.

  • Flexibility & Comfort:

    • Lightweight and soft to the touch, reducing skin irritation for direct-contact uses (e.g., backpack straps, pet collars).

  • Customization Potential:

    • Widths range from 1/4" to 12", thicknesses from 0.3mm to 2mm, with options for reflective strips, waterproofing, or flame retardancy.

2. Customization Process

Step 1: Define Requirements

  • Load Capacity:

    • Determine minimum breaking strength (e.g., 1,000 lbs for pet collars vs. 6,000 lbs for rescue gear).

  • Environmental Exposure:

    • Specify UV resistance for outdoor use or chemical resistance for industrial settings.

  • Aesthetic & Functional Needs:

    • Choose colors, patterns, or branding elements (e.g., logos, jacquard weaves).

Step 2: Material Selection

  • Nylon 6 vs. Nylon 6,6:

    • Nylon 6,6 offers higher melting points and better UV resistance, while Nylon 6 is more cost-effective for indoor applications.

  • Hybrid Options:

    • Combine nylon with polyester or Kevlar for enhanced stretch control or cut resistance.

Step 3: Production & Quality Control

  • Weaving Patterns:

    • Custom patterns (e.g., tubular, flat, or jacquard) optimize strength-to-weight ratios.

  • Edge Finishing:

    • Heat-cut or ultrasonic sealing prevents fraying.

  • Testing:

    • Rigorous tensile, abrasion, and environmental tests ensure compliance with standards like MIL-SPEC, ANSI/ISEA, or UIAA.

Step 4: Post-Production Treatments

  • Functional Coatings:

    • Apply antimicrobial treatments for medical use or waterproofing for marine applications.

  • Hardware Integration:

    • Add grommets, D-rings, or buckles during manufacturing for ready-to-use straps.

3. Industry-Specific Applications

IndustryUse CaseCustom Features
SafetyFall protection harnessesFlame-retardant coating, reinforced edges
OutdoorTent guy lines, backpack strapsReflective strips, UV stabilization
AutomotiveCargo tie-downs, seatbelt componentsAbrasion-resistant weave, corrosion-resistant hardware
MedicalPatient restraints, surgical slingsAntimicrobial treatment, soft-touch finish
FashionBag straps, belt loopsJacquard weaving for branding, vibrant dyes

4. Key Considerations

  • Stretch Control:

    • Pre-tensioning processes reduce elongation by 60–70% for applications requiring minimal stretch (e.g., lifting slings).

  • Dimensional Stability:

    • Avoid nylon for precision applications (e.g., aerospace) where polyester or Kevlar may be better suited.

  • Lifecycle Costs:

    • Solution-dyed nylon with UV resistance offers better long-term value for outdoor use than standard grades.
